In the early and mid-1800s, how did the economies of the Northern and Southern states compare?

History
2 answers:
Elan Coil [88]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

In the North, the economy was based on industry. They built factories and manufactured products to sell to other countries and to the southern states. They did not do a lot of farming because the soil was rocky and the colder climate made for a shorter growing season. ... In the South, the economy was based on agriculture.
